Understanding Yang Yan: More Than Just Skincare

"Yang Yan," translated from Chinese, literally means "nourishing beauty." However, in the context of internet slang, it encompasses a broader concept that goes beyond mere skincare. It refers to the holistic approach of nurturing one’s appearance through diet, exercise, mental health, and, of course, skincare routines. In essence, "Yang Yan" is about investing in yourself and your overall well-being, not just your physical looks.

This term has taken root in Western internet culture, particularly among younger generations who are increasingly focused on self-improvement and personal growth. Platforms like TikTok, Instagram, and YouTube are filled with content creators sharing their "Yang Yan" journeys, from detailed skincare regimens to healthy eating habits and mindfulness practices.

The Evolution of "Yang Yan" in Online Culture

The rise of "Yang Yan" reflects a shift towards a more inclusive and holistic view of beauty. Unlike traditional beauty standards that often emphasize quick fixes and external enhancements, "Yang Yan" promotes a long-term, sustainable approach to looking and feeling good. This shift is mirrored in the increasing popularity of natural and organic products, as well as the growing interest in wellness and mental health.

Moreover, "Yang Yan" has become a way for individuals to express themselves and their unique identities. By customizing their routines based on their specific needs and preferences, people can tailor their self-care practices to reflect their personalities and lifestyles. This personalization is a key aspect of the trend, making it resonate deeply with those seeking authenticity and individuality.

Practical Tips for Embracing "Yang Yan" in Your Life

If you’re intrigued by the idea of "Yang Yan" and want to incorporate it into your daily routine, there are several steps you can take:

  • Start Small: Begin with simple changes, such as adding a hydrating face mask to your weekly routine or swapping out sugary snacks for healthier alternatives.
  • Listen to Your Body: Pay attention to what works best for you. Everyone’s skin and body are different, so find what nourishes you the most.
  • Stay Consistent: Consistency is key when it comes to seeing results. Stick to your chosen regimen and give it time to work.
  • Embrace Mindfulness: Incorporate mindfulness exercises like meditation or yoga to help manage stress and improve mental clarity.
